Badge Développement

Introduction aux bases de données

Cette formation permet aux participants de découvrir les concepts de la modélisation des données et leurs fondements mathématiques. L’objectif est de préparer les participants à des cours pratiques de SQL en introduisant tous les concepts et la logique inhérente à la manipulation des données.

: 3 jours

750€

  • Définir le concept de bases de données
  • Comprendre le rôle de la modélisation des bases de données
  • Modéliser une base de données avec le modèle relationnel
  • Utiliser les concepts du modèle relationnel
  • Comprendre les fondements de la manipulation des données
  • Utiliser les opérateurs d’algèbre relationnel pour répondre à une requête
  • Manipuler l’ensemble des opérateurs d’algèbre relationnelle
  • Utiliser l’arbre algébrique pour construire une requête
  • Utiliser les fonctions et agrégat

Connaissances en algorithmique


  • Introduction
    • Rôles et utilisation des données
    • Présentation des SGBDs
    • Les intérêts de la modélisation
  • Modélisation relationnelle des données
    • Schéma relationnel : relation, attribut, domaine
    • Valeur relationnel : tuple, ensemble
    • Clef : superclef, candidate, primaire
    • Contrainte relationnelle, contrainte d’intégrité
    • Types de données
    • Relation dérivée, vue et instantané
    • Opération relationnelle : insertion, suppression, modification
  • Introduction à l’algèbre relationnelle
    • Introduction
    • Concepts
    • Création d’une base de données relationnelle
  • Les opérateurs de l’algèbre relationnelle
    • Introduction
    • Les opérateurs unitaires
    • Les opérateurs ensemblistes
    • Les jointures
    • L’arbre algébrique
    • Fonctions et agrégats


Nous utilisons des cookies à des fins statistiques et pour faciliter la navigation et le partage social.